units cribsheet

In general, use the units specified in the problem. Represent units as indicated in the table below, including them separated from your answer by a space (also, be sure there are no spaces at the end of your units). Note that cApITaliZaTiON matters. Enter compound units with only one "/", using * for multiplication and ^ for exponentiation. For example, the following are all correct ways to enter a value with compound units: 5 m/s^2,   7.38 kg*m/s^2,   12 V*ohm^-1*s^-1   and 16 V/ohm*s.
